I also got the Japanese smart key cases.

The buttons on the outside of the case are really functional. I have no problem in pressing the buttons without taking out the key fobs.

The small incompatibility is that the Japanese key fob has 3 buttons, ie, door unlock, door lock and trunk open. Besides the Japanese trunk open button is situated somewhere between our trunk open and the panic buttons. You just have to get used to putting your finger a bit off from where the mark for the trunk open in order to access either the trunk open or the panic buttons.

Note the zipper can come in different colors. The black one comes with a black zipper whereare the tan has a silver zipper.

The inside of the key case is made of very soft material which appears to be suede. See the pictures.
